当前位置:首页 / EXCEL

Excel如何自动计算单价?如何设置公式实现?

作者:佚名|分类:EXCEL|浏览:65|发布时间:2025-03-17 04:16:23

Excel如何自动计算单价?如何设置公式实现?

在Excel中,自动计算单价是一个常见的需求,尤其是在处理销售数据、成本分析或者库存管理时。通过使用Excel的公式功能,我们可以轻松地计算出单价。以下是如何在Excel中自动计算单价以及如何设置公式的详细步骤。

一、理解单价计算的基本概念

在计算单价之前,我们需要明确以下几个概念:

总价:商品或服务的总费用。

数量:购买或销售的商品或服务的数量。

单价:总价除以数量得到的结果。

二、自动计算单价的步骤

1. 准备数据

首先,确保你的Excel表格中有以下列:

总价(假设在A列)

数量(假设在B列)

2. 选择计算单元格

在Excel中,选择一个空白单元格,这个单元格将用于显示单价。

3. 输入公式

在选定的单元格中,输入以下公式:

```excel

=A2/B2

```

这里,`A2`代表总价所在的单元格,`B2`代表数量所在的单元格。如果你选择的是第一行数据,那么公式应该是:

```excel

=A1/B1

```

4. 按下回车键

输入公式后,按下回车键,Excel将自动计算出单价,并将结果显示在所选单元格中。

5. 复制公式

如果你有多行数据需要计算单价,可以选中包含公式的单元格,然后将鼠标移至单元格右下角,当鼠标变成一个黑色十字时,拖动鼠标向下填充到所有需要计算单价的单元格。

三、设置公式实现单价的注意事项

数据格式:确保总价和数量列的数据格式是正确的,例如,总价应该是数字格式,数量也应该是数字格式。

单元格引用:如果你拖动公式填充,Excel会自动调整单元格引用,确保每个单价计算都是基于正确的总价和数量。

错误处理:如果公式中出现除数为零的情况,Excel会显示“DIV/0!”错误。确保数量列中没有零值。

四、相关问答

1. 如何处理单价计算中的小数点?

Excel默认会将计算结果保留两位小数。如果你需要更多或更少的小数位数,可以在公式中添加`ROUND`函数。例如,以下公式将结果保留到小数点后四位:

```excel

=ROUND(A2/B2, 4)

```

2. 如果总价和数量在多行中,如何一次性计算所有单价的平均值?

你可以使用`AVERAGE`函数来计算所有单价的平均值。首先,你需要将所有单价计算到单独的列中,然后使用以下公式:

```excel

=AVERAGE(C2:C100)

```

这里,`C2:C100`代表包含所有单价的列的范围。

3. 如何在单价计算中使用货币格式?

在Excel中,你可以通过以下步骤将单价设置为货币格式:

选中包含单价的列。

在“开始”选项卡中,点击“货币”按钮。

选择你想要的货币符号和格式。

这样,单价就会以货币格式显示。

通过以上步骤,你可以在Excel中轻松地自动计算单价,并设置相应的公式来实现这一功能。这不仅提高了工作效率,也使得数据处理更加准确和直观。